Nvidia 系列显卡大解析 B100、A40、A100、A800、H100、H800、V100 该如何选择,各自的配置详细与架构详细介绍,分别运用于哪些项目场景
在当今高速发展的科技领域,尤其是人工智能、图形渲染、科学计算等行业,高性能计算的需求日益增长,而Nvidia作为图形处理器(GPU)领域的领头羊,其系列显卡成为了众多专业人士与爱好者的首选。本部分旨在为读者提供一个全面的Nvidia系列显卡选择的概览,深入探讨为何深入解析这些显卡至关重要,以及正确选择显卡对于提升工作效率和优化项目成本的意义。在深入探讨 NVIDIA B100 显卡之前,有必要明确
大家好,我是微学AI,今天给大家介绍一下本文深入解析了Nvidia系列显卡B100、A40、A100、A800、H100、H800、V100的配置细节和架构特点,并探讨了它们在不同项目场景中的适用性。通过对这些显卡的性能参数和实际应用场景的分析,为读者在选择合适显卡时提供了详细的参考依据。文章详细介绍了各类显卡的架构设计、运算能力及功耗等关键信息,助力用户根据自身需求作出最佳选择。
文章目录
一、Nvidia 系列显卡介绍及选择概述
在当今高速发展的科技领域,尤其是人工智能、图形渲染、科学计算等行业,高性能计算的需求日益增长,而Nvidia作为图形处理器(GPU)领域的领头羊,其系列显卡成为了众多专业人士与爱好者的首选。本部分旨在为读者提供一个全面的Nvidia系列显卡选择的概览,深入探讨为何深入解析这些显卡至关重要,以及正确选择显卡对于提升工作效率和优化项目成本的意义。
1.1 Nvidia显卡在现代计算中的地位
1.1.1 GPU技术革命
自CUDA编程模型问世以来,Nvidia显卡不仅仅是游戏和图形处理的加速器,更成为了通用并行计算的强力引擎。通过利用数千个CUDA Core并行处理大量数据,Nvidia显卡在深度学习、高性能计算、大数据分析等领域展现出了前所未有的计算能力,推动了AI、医疗研究、金融分析等多个行业的技术创新。
1.1.2 产品线概览
Nvidia的产品线覆盖广泛,从面向消费者的GeForce系列,到专为专业人士设计的Quadro、Tesla系列,再到数据中心级别的Ampere架构高性能显卡,每一系列都针对不同的应用场景进行了优化,满足了从日常娱乐到极端计算的多元化需求。
1.2 选择显卡的重要性
1.2.1 性能匹配
正确的显卡选择是确保项目成功的关键。不同显卡的性能差异直接影响着数据处理速度、模型训练效率等关键指标。例如,在深度学习训练中,高配置的GPU如A100能够显著缩短训练周期,提高迭代速度,这对于科研项目或企业研发而言至关重要。
1.2.2 成本效益
选择显卡时,性价比也是不可忽视的因素。投资过于高端的显卡可能会造成资源过剩,增加不必要的成本;反之,如果显卡性能不足,则可能限制项目的发展潜力,导致效率低下。因此,根据实际应用需求精确匹配显卡性能,是实现成本效益最大化的关键。
1.2.3 功能特性适应性
每款Nvidia显卡都有其独特的功能集,如Tensor Cores对于加速AI运算、RT Cores对于实时光线追踪的支持等。根据项目的具体需求选择具备相应特性的显卡,可以最大化地发挥硬件效能。例如,游戏开发者可能更关注支持实时光线追踪的显卡,而数据科学家则可能偏好拥有大量Tensor Cores的型号以加速矩阵运算。
1.3 引入后续部分
鉴于上述原因,对Nvidia系列显卡进行细致的解析和比较是十分必要的。接下来的章节中,我们将逐一深入到B100、A40等特定型号,详尽分析它们的核心配置、架构特点及其在特定项目场景下的表现。此外,还会进行A100、A800、H100、H800、V100等高端显卡的对比分析,帮助读者理解它们在深度学习、高性能计算等领域的差异和优势。最终,我们将在总结部分根据前面的分析,给出针对不同需求的Nvidia系列显卡选择建议,为读者在面对复杂多变的项目需求时,提供清晰的指导思路。
本部分为理解Nvidia系列显卡选择的重要性奠定了基础,同时也为即将展开的详细解析与对比构建了逻辑框架,旨在帮助专业人士和爱好者在浩瀚的显卡市场中找到最适合自身需求的解决方案。
第二部分:B100 显卡详细解析
2.1 B100 显卡配置与架构概述
在深入探讨 NVIDIA B100 显卡之前,有必要明确其市场定位——专为数据中心设计的高效能计算(HPC)与人工智能(AI)加速器。这款显卡基于 NVIDIA Ampere 架构,是专为大规模机器学习训练、推理以及高性能数据分析而优化的解决方案。
2.1.1 CUDA Core 细节
B100 配备了大量 CUDA Cores,这些核心是 GPU 并行处理的核心单元,负责执行通用计算任务。虽然具体核心数量因保密和产品迭代可能未公开详述,但可以确认的是,这些核心通过高密度并行处理能力,显著提高了在大规模矩阵运算和复杂算法上的执行效率,这对于机器学习模型训练至关重要。
2.1.2 Tensor Core 与 AI 加速
B100 显卡的一大亮点在于其强大的 Tensor Cores,专为加速深度学习中常见的张量运算(如卷积、矩阵乘法)而设计。这些核心通过混合精度计算(FP16/FP32/TF32/INT8/INT4)提供极高的吞吐量,极大加速了深度神经网络的训练和推理过程。例如,在使用 FP16 或 TF32 模式时,Tensor Cores 能够实现比传统 CUDA Core 高几个数量级的性能提升,这对于大规模语言模型训练或图像识别任务尤为重要。
2.1.3 RT Core 与实时光线追踪
尽管 B100 主要面向数据中心的计算密集型应用,不直接专注于图形渲染,但 NVIDIA Ampere 架构引入的 RT Core 依然在一定程度上提升了其在光线追踪计算方面的能力。这使得 B100 在需要实时物理模拟或光线追踪的特定应用场景中也能展现出一定的潜力,比如在建筑可视化或复杂数据分析可视化方面,虽然这不是其主要设计目的。
2.2 性能特点分析
B100 显卡凭借其高度优化的硬件架构和庞大的计算资源,展现出卓越的计算性能。其高带宽内存(HBM2e)设计确保了大规模数据集快速传输,减少了数据瓶颈,这对于需要频繁访问大数据集的 AI 和数据分析任务尤为关键。此外,高效的功耗管理设计使得 B100 在提供强大算力的同时,保持了良好的能耗比,降低了运营成本,符合数据中心对能效的高要求。
2.3 应用场景探讨
2.3.1 人工智能项目
在人工智能领域,B100 显卡是大型分布式训练作业的理想选择。它能够有效支持大规模机器学习模型的快速迭代,如在自然语言处理、计算机视觉、推荐系统等应用中,帮助研究者和工程师迅速验证模型,缩短产品上市时间。
2.3.2 图形处理与数据分析
尽管不是专为图形处理设计,B100 的高性能计算能力使其也能在一些高级图形处理和数据分析任务中发挥作用。例如,在大规模地理空间数据分析、气候模型预测、基因组学研究等需要大量并行计算的场景中,B100 能显著提高处理速度和精度。
2.3.3 数据中心基础设施
作为数据中心的基础设施组件,B100 显卡能够无缝集成到现有的 GPU 计算集群中,支持云服务提供商和企业构建灵活、可扩展的计算平台,满足从基础科研到复杂商业应用的各种需求。
综上所述,NVIDIA B100 显卡凭借其在CUDA Core、Tensor Core、RT Core等核心参数上的优化设计,以及针对数据中心特定工作负载的高效架构,成为了推动人工智能和高性能计算领域进步的重要力量。无论是对于追求极致计算效率的AI研究团队,还是需要处理海量数据分析的企业,B100都是一款值得信赖的高性能解决方案。
三、A40 显卡详细解析
3.1 A40 显卡核心配置与显存规格
A40显卡是NVIDIA针对数据中心和专业工作负载优化的一款高性能GPU,特别适合于需要高吞吐量和高效能比的应用场景。在核心配置方面,A40搭载了基于Ampere架构的GPU,配备了多达4864个CUDA Cores,这一数量级的核心使得它在执行大规模并行计算任务时表现出色。此外,它还集成了64个第二代RT Cores和256个第三代Tensor Cores,为光线追踪和AI加速任务提供了强大的支持。
在显存配置上,A40装备了24GB的高速GDDR6内存,拥有448GB/s的显存带宽,这确保了在处理大数据集时的高效数据交换能力,对于大规模的科学模拟、深度学习模型训练等内存密集型应用尤为重要。
3.2 架构优势分析
3.2.1 Ampere架构的革新
A40显卡基于Ampere架构,该架构相较于前一代拥有显著的效率提升。它采用了更先进的制程技术,提高了单位面积上的晶体管密度,这意味着更多的计算资源可以在更小的空间内集成,从而实现更高的能源效率。Ampere架构通过改进的流式多处理器(SM)设计,增强了单线程和多线程性能,使得每个CUDA Core的执行效率大幅提升。
3.2.2 高效的并发处理能力
A40显卡的CUDA Core数量庞大,配合改进的并发执行机制,能够在同一时间内处理更多线程,这对于科学计算中的大规模矩阵运算、图像渲染等任务至关重要。第二代RT Cores和第三代Tensor Cores的加入,则使得该卡在实时光线追踪和深度学习推理方面具有显著优势,特别是在处理复杂的物理模拟和大规模神经网络训练时,能够提供更快的处理速度和更高的精度。
3.3 应用场景分析
3.3.1 科学计算与高性能计算
在科学计算领域,A40显卡凭借其庞大的计算资源和高带宽显存,成为复杂模拟、数据分析和计算密集型研究的理想选择。比如,在气候模型模拟、药物研发中的分子动力学模拟、或是天文学中的宇宙模拟中,A40能有效缩短计算周期,加速科学发现。
3.3.2 游戏开发与图形渲染
尽管A40主要面向数据中心和专业应用,但在高端游戏开发和专业级图形渲染领域,它同样展现出了非凡价值。开发者可以利用其高级图形处理能力和大量显存来创建超高质量的3D场景和动画,特别是在开发过程中涉及复杂的物理模拟和实时光线追踪时,A40的性能优势更加明显。
3.3.3 AI开发与深度学习
A40显卡的Tensor Cores和RT Cores使其在AI开发和深度学习领域尤为突出。在训练大规模深度学习模型时,其高效的矩阵运算能力和优化的AI算法加速,能够显著缩短训练时间,提高迭代效率。对于需要快速验证模型、处理大量数据集的科研人员和企业而言,A40是推动AI创新的强大工具。
综上所述,NVIDIA A40显卡凭借其在核心配置、架构优势及广泛的应用场景覆盖,成为了专业领域中不可或缺的高性能计算平台。无论是追求极致的科学研究、追求效率的游戏开发,还是推动边界的人工智能探索,A40都能提供强大的支持,满足最苛刻的工作负载需求。
四、A100、A800、H100、H800、V100 显卡对比解析
在高性能计算与专业应用领域,NVIDIA 的一系列高端显卡成为了科研、工程及数据中心的中流砥柱。本部分将深入对比分析 A100、A800、H100、H800、V100 这五款显卡,从配置参数、架构特色到应用场景,全方位展现它们各自的强项与差异。
4.1 配置参数对比
4.1.1 CUDA Core & Tensor Core 比较
- A100:作为Ampere架构的旗舰产品,A100拥有6912个CUDA Core和432个Tensor Core,专为大规模并行计算优化。
- A800:与A100基于相同架构,但针对特定市场调整,同样具备6912个CUDA Core和432个Tensor Core。
- H100:基于最新的Hopper架构,H100拥有惊人的16432个CUDA Core和512个Tensor Core,显著提升了AI训练与推理的效率。
- H800:虽然命名接近,但H800并非Hopper架构产品,它更像是专为某些特定需求设计的变体,CUDA Core与Tensor Core的数量未公开明确,通常不直接参与此类高性能计算的直接对比。
- V100:作为上一代Volta架构的代表,V100配置了5120个CUDA Core和640个Tensor Core,尽管较新架构有所逊色,但在其时代是深度学习和科学计算的重要力量。
4.1.2 显存与带宽
显卡型号 | 显存 | 带宽 |
---|---|---|
A100 | 提供40GB和80GBHBM2e两种版本,内存带宽高达2TB/s(80GB版本) | 600GB/s(原始),A800是其特供版,带宽降至400GB/s |
A800 | 相关资料未提及具体显存类型及确切容量,可推测与A100类似 | 400GB/s |
H100 | 80GBHBM3显存,带宽最高达3TB/s | 相关资料未提及确切带宽受管制后的数值,H800是其特供版,芯片间数据传输速度是H100的一半 |
H800 | 类型与容量可能是80GBHBM2e或GDDR6(具体规格可能依据不同的市场和配置而异) | 芯片间数据传输速度是H100的一半,但H100确切带宽受管制后数值未知,原始H100带宽为3TB/s |
V100 | 32G显存版本 | 相关资料未提及显存类型、容量及带宽具体数值 |
4.2 架构特点分析
4.2.1 Ampere vs. Hopper
- Ampere(A100/A800):引入了第三代Tensor Core,支持稀疏运算,极大提升了AI训练效率;同时优化了RT Core,增强了光线追踪能力。
- Hopper(H100):首次引入Transformer Engine,针对Transformer模型优化,大幅度加速了自然语言处理和推荐系统等任务;升级的多实例GPU(MIG)技术使得资源分配更加灵活高效。
4.2.2 Volta(V100)
- V100作为Volta架构的旗舰,其Tensor Core首次集成于消费级GPU中,为深度学习训练带来了革命性的加速,尽管在最新架构面前稍显过时,但仍能在一些旧有系统和预算受限的应用中发挥余热。
4.3 应用场景与适用性
4.3.1 深度学习与AI
- A100/A800:凭借强大的Tensor Core和高带宽显存,非常适合大规模深度学习训练与推理,广泛应用于科研和企业级AI开发。
- H100:以其超高的计算力和优化的Transformer Engine,成为处理大规模语言模型、推荐系统的最佳选择。
- V100:适合中大型企业的AI研发团队,用于平衡成本与性能的解决方案。
4.3.2 高性能计算
- A100/A800/H100:这三款显卡在高性能计算领域均有出色表现,特别是在气候模拟、药物发现、金融风险分析等需要大量浮点运算和并行处理的任务中。
- H800:因其公开信息有限,难以直接评估其在HPC领域的定位,但考虑到NVIDIA的一贯策略,可能在特定细分市场有其独到之处。
- V100:虽不是最前沿选择,但在预算有限的HPC项目中,仍能提供足够的计算能力支撑科学研究。
4.3.3 其他专业应用
- 图形处理与渲染:V100和H系列因强大的浮点运算能力,在专业图形处理软件中表现优异,尤其在电影特效制作、建筑可视化等场景。
- 科学计算:A100与H100由于其高带宽内存和优化的并行计算架构,成为复杂科学模拟和数据分析的理想平台。
结论
通过上述对比,我们可以看到,A100、A800、H100、H800、V100各有千秋,选择哪一款显卡需根据具体的应用场景、预算限制以及对未来技术发展的预期来决定。Ampere架构的A系列和Hopper架构的H100在深度学习、高性能计算等前沿科技领域展现出无可比拟的优势,而V100依然在特定场合保持其价值。了解每款产品的特性与限制,才能做出最适合项目需求的选择。
五、Nvidia 系列显卡选择建议总结
在深入分析了Nvidia系列中B100、A40以及A100、A800、H100、H800、V100等显卡的详细配置与应用场景后,我们不难发现每款显卡都有其独特的设计定位与性能优势,适合于不同的工作负载与预算范围。本部分将综合这些分析,提供针对性的选卡建议,旨在帮助用户根据实际需求高效选择最适合的Nvidia显卡。
5.1 预算敏感型项目选择
5.1.1 入门级AI与轻度图形处理
对于预算有限但需要进行基本人工智能训练、机器学习入门或轻度图形设计的用户,B100显卡是一个不错的选择。尽管其CUDA Core数量可能不如高端型号,但凭借合理的性能与功耗平衡,B100能在成本控制的同时满足基础的计算需求。适合初创企业或个人开发者用于初步项目探索。
5.1.2 高性价比科学计算与渲染
A40显卡凭借其均衡的配置,在科学计算、中等级别的图形渲染以及游戏开发中展现出高性价比。它在保持相对经济的价格的同时,提供了足够的显存容量和核心数,适合那些对计算能力有一定要求,但预算又不足以负担旗舰级显卡的项目。
5.2 性能导向型应用推荐
5.2.1 高端科研与深度学习
在深度学习、大规模科学计算及高性能计算领域,A100、H100和V100是首选。A100以其强大的Tensor Core和大量显存,特别适合大规模的AI模型训练和推理。H100作为最新一代,更是提升了数据传输速度和计算效率,适合未来导向的AI研究。V100则是成熟可靠的选择,适用于要求严苛的HPC环境。
5.2.2 特定行业标准与合规性
A800和H800显卡则是在特定地区(如遵循出口管制法规)内高性能计算的理想替代品,它们在保持与A100、H100相似的性能水平的同时,确保了合规性。这些显卡适合需要严格遵守国际贸易规定的机构或项目。
5.3 综合考量因素
5.3.1 项目场景匹配度
在选择Nvidia显卡时,首要考虑的是显卡与项目需求的匹配度。例如,深度学习训练更看重Tensor Core的数量和显存大小,而图形渲染则可能更关注CUDA Core和显卡的图形处理能力。
5.3.2 功耗与散热
高性能显卡往往伴随着高功耗,因此在选择时也需考虑系统的散热能力和能源成本。数据中心或高性能集群应优先考虑能效比高的显卡,如B100在低功耗下的稳定表现。
5.3.3 预算与投资回报率
预算规划是选型中不可忽视的一环。投资高端显卡虽能带来显著的性能提升,但也要评估项目周期内的投资回报率,确保投资与预期收益相匹配。
5.3.4 未来扩展性
考虑显卡对未来技术发展的兼容性,如支持最新的编程模型、API和硬件加速特性,这有助于延长硬件生命周期,减少未来升级成本。Nvidia系列显卡的选择是一个综合性能、预算、应用场景及长远规划的决策过程。通过细致地评估上述各点,用户可以更加精准地定位到最适合自己项目需求的显卡型号,实现资源的最大化利用与项目目标的高效达成。
更多推荐
所有评论(0)